From deebe8992db13f74135c2119d376431e69056fe9 Mon Sep 17 00:00:00 2001 From: Peter Dettman Date: Thu, 27 Apr 2023 13:59:54 +0700 Subject: May some KeyParameter methods public --- crypto/src/crypto/parameters/KeyParameter.cs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/crypto/src/crypto/parameters/KeyParameter.cs b/crypto/src/crypto/parameters/KeyParameter.cs index c29dfe61b..592c35008 100644 --- a/crypto/src/crypto/parameters/KeyParameter.cs +++ b/crypto/src/crypto/parameters/KeyParameter.cs @@ -62,7 +62,7 @@ namespace Org.BouncyCastle.Crypto.Parameters m_key = new byte[length]; } - internal void CopyTo(byte[] buf, int off, int len) + public void CopyTo(byte[] buf, int off, int len) { if (m_key.Length != len) throw new ArgumentOutOfRangeException(nameof(len)); @@ -86,7 +86,7 @@ namespace Org.BouncyCastle.Crypto.Parameters internal ReadOnlySpan Key => m_key; #endif - internal KeyParameter Reverse() + public KeyParameter Reverse() { var reversed = new KeyParameter(m_key.Length); Arrays.Reverse(m_key, reversed.m_key); -- cgit 1.4.1